How to implement real-time menu without delays?

Two approaches. Static menu — JSON loaded at startup, cached for 24 hours. Simple, works offline. But the stop-list lags, possible orders of unavailable items. Dynamic menu — request before every action, always up-to-date, but slower and requires internet. Compromise (our choice): cache for 5–15 minutes and refresh the cart with availability check for each item. Stop-list — a separate endpoint /menu/stop-list, updated via WebSocket. Compared to traditional polling, WebSocket reduces stop-list update latency by 10 times, ensuring accuracy under 500 ms. Unavailable dishes shown with a "Temporarily unavailable" label — this reduces cancellations by 20% according to our data. Our digital menu for restaurant includes this feature.

Parameter Static menu Dynamic menu Compromise (our choice)
Stop-list accuracy Up to 24h delay Instant Up to 15 min + cart refresh
Offline capability Yes No Yes (cache)
Load speed High Low Medium
User experience May order unavailable Always accurate Nearly ideal

Table booking: from floor plan to reminder

Floor plan — SVG or Canvas with clickable tables. Each table stores capacity and status (free/occupied/reserved). Status updates via WebSocket or polling every 30–60 seconds. Booking form: date, time, number of guests, name, phone. After confirmation — SMS and push notification with details. One hour before the visit — reminder push. Cancellation via the app, slot automatically freed. The table booking app reduces no-shows by 15%.

Pre-order and delivery: two scenarios

Takeaway mode — user orders in advance, specifies ready time. Statuses: received → preparing → ready. Push on each status. Delivery — separate logic: zones (polygon on map), minimum amount, cost calculation. Integration with Places API for address autocomplete. The pre-order food app allows customers to schedule orders. Why should a loyalty program be built from the first release?

Accumulated points are the foundation of retention. Scheme: X points for Y rubles, spend no more than N% of order. Balance on the home screen. QR code for offline visits: a unique QR (JWT-signed with timestamp to prevent reuse) generated in the app, the cashier scans — points are credited. Push campaigns: "Your points expire in 30 days", "You haven't visited us in 2 weeks — here's a promo code". Segmentation via FCM Topic subscriptions. POS integration

POS systems: iiko, r_keeper, Poster. Each has a REST API for order transmission. For example, iiko API: we send an order with modifiers, get orderId, track status — the chef sees the order on the kitchen screen. If integration is not in the first version — sync via a tablet app for staff with notifications. Stack and architecture: Flutter vs native

Flutter with BLoC for order state (predictable states, easy to test). dio + retrofit for API, hive for menu cache, flutter_local_notifications + FCM for notifications. Native development — if deep integration with NFC or Bluetooth printer is needed. Flutter development is 2 times faster than native for similar features. WebSocket setup for stop-list
  1. On server: separate endpoint /ws/stop-list with JWT authentication.
  2. On client connect: send current stop-list and subscribe to updates.
  3. On change: broadcast to all active sessions; on client update UI without full rebuild.
  4. On connection drop: automatic reconnect with exponential backoff (1s → 2s → 4s).
  5. For metrics: log update latency (target under 500 ms).
